Eyeglass Case From A Tie

Why oh why is the easiest way not the best way? It is? Then why don’t I remember that? Last weekend I made an eyeglass case from a tie. I took a lot of time and hand sewed it. But it came out wonky. It was crooked and rumpled. Then I thought of an easy way. I remembered the great success that I have had using tacky glue on my placemat clutch purses. I ripped out all of the stitches and started again and it came out perfect! Here is how I made an eyeglass case from a tie the easy way.

I have quite a few tie remnants left over from my necktie headbands. I cut the fat end of the tie, measuring my glasses and adding a couple of inches.

I ran a bead of tacky glue down one side.

I shaped it around my glasses and pressed it into place so it fit around the rounded glasses but still looked straight on the outside.

I let it dry completely. I then turned it inside out and glued the bottom closed. Sorry but I don’t have photos of that part of the process. When that was dry I turned it right side out again. I added Velcro closures.
